KO is a status in Final Fantasy.

Content in italics is exclusive to the Dawn of Souls and/or 20th Anniversary releases.

Mechanics[]

Entities with 0 HP are KO'd in battle, unable to act until revived. Some abilities are also able to inflict the status, reducing one to 0 HP without dealing numerical damage. KO'd party members are flagged as defeated for Game Over purposes. Unlike later games, resting effects like inns or Tents have no effect on KO'd party members; the victim must be revived separately before resting.

KO'd enemies are removed from battle entirely and cannot return. KO'd party members remain in battle, but have all other statuses removed, and are unaffected by anything bar effects that remove the KO status.

It is not possible to resist or be immune to the KO status, the most one can do is resist the element of an attack that inflicts the status, reducing its accuracy. Even if a target is listed as resisting Instant Death, this is in reference to the element, rather than effects that can instantly KO.
